DCM software is used by engineers, architects, and relevant consultants in planning, designing, constructing, operating, and maintaining buildings and other infrastructures. Aside from buildings, it DCMs can be used in diverse applications like HVAC utilities, water, electricity, gas, communication, roads, bridges, and other structural thingamajigs. This intelligent 3D process gives professionals the tools and insight to do manage projects more efficiently.

Digital construction is used synonymously or else paired inseparably with Digital Engineering. If you want to be technical about terminology, let us just say that the latter mostly has to do with the precursor stages. It concerns itself mostly with the design phase. It is used in the creation of digitized engineering content and models.
